is it ok to drink before the age of 21 as long as you're 18?!


Question: Is it ok to drink before the age of 21 as long as you're 18?
i'm turning 18 in march and i was just wondering.

Answers:

Best Answer - Chosen by Voters

Firstly; Ignore anyone telling you it's illegal to drink under the age of 21 in the USA - It is illegal to BUY alcohol under the age of 21, however in most states it is perfectly legal for U21s to drink, as long as certain conditions are met (either being at home, or with parents, or both)
